Wow, what an amazing weekend!

On a cold, snowy weekend in November, I can't imagine a more Alaskan thing to do than have a Winterseed!

And apparently, I'm not alone in that  ;D ;D. On Saturday morning, 14 of my fellow Alaskans decided to come out and learn how to become Riflemen. It was a pretty chilly day, but everyone stuck with it right up until the end.

Come Sunday morning, despite a nasty little storm rolling in, 9 hearty souls came back for more. After a quick review, we started in on the patented AQT grind. Despite the weather, no one really wanted to go home!

In the spirit of true perseverance, we added 2 new riflemen for our ranks!

Nathaniel, on Saturday got a 212!

Shad on Sunday got a 214!

And one of our Distinguished Riflemen, Christian, came to collect his Winterseed patch with a 225!

I would like to thank ALL our students for coming out to show everyone what Alaska's all about.

And I would like to thank my Instructors for coming out and working their butts off in some pretty nasty weather.

I hope to see all of you on the range next year!
